ABOUT LANDSCAPE STRUCTURES
Landscape Structures Inc. has been the leading manufacturer of commercial playground equipment in the world for more than 50 years. Our employee-owned company designs community and school playgrounds that encourage kids of all ages and abilities to learn persistence, leadership, competition, bravery, support, and empathy through play. Landscape Structures pushes the limits—of design, inclusion, and play—to help kids realize there is no limit to what they can do today and in the future. For a better tomorrow, we play today.
Position Summary
We’re looking for an energetic, curious, and detail‑driven intern to join our Custom Engineering Team! As a Custom Engineering Intern, you’ll get hands‑on experience updating BOMs, working in PDM, and bringing SolidWorks models to life. You’ll dive into real projects and see firsthand how we design and engineer one‑of‑a‑kind custom playground products used in communities across the country. If you’re eager to learn, grow, and make an impact, this is the place to do it.
This internship is located in Delano, MN and will require on-site participation 5 days a week.

D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ES
- Assist with engineering projects as assigned, with oversight from experienced engineers.
- Support updates to Product Data Management (PDM) data cards.
- Support the update of Bills of Materials (BOM).
- Assist with revision updates, basic model updates and color classification updates.

QUALIFICATIONS
- Currently pursuing a degree in Engineering or a related field.
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
- Ability to work independently and as part of a team.
- Detail-oriented with a focus on accuracy.
- Experience in Material Requirements Planning (MRP) systems preferred
- Experience in SolidWorks is required.
- Experience in 3D modeling or CAD software is preferred.
The target hourly range is $19.00 - $21.00, depending upon qualifications and experience. The posted pay range reflects the expected compensation for a fully qualified candidate. Starting pay may be above or below this range based on job-related factors such as skills, experience, qualifications, and training needs.
In addition to hourly pay, the compensation package also includes eligibility for profit-sharing and monthly bonus opportunity. Additionally, for eligible full-time employees, we offer a competitive benefits package including medical, dental, vision, life, and disability benefits; paid time off and paid holidays; 401(k) retirement plan and employee stock ownership plan.
